Chili Altar
Claude Jammet (Simbabwe 1953)
Lot-No. 260
2008-9, oil/canv., 80 x 60 cm, lo. r. sign. and dat. C. Jammet 8-9, on reverse titled on the strecher Chili Altar. - Provenance: Coll. E. Gargioni, Torino. - South African artist. J. has french parents and grew up in Kenya, India, Japan u. France before settling in South Africa and starting a professional career as a painter. Since the late 1990's she lives and works in Genoa / Italy. As an artist, J. is completely self-taught. Painting for her is a requirement; the chosen means by which to communicate her experience of the world. J. has held some 20 solo exhibitions as well as group shows in galleries across South Africa, Europe and Japan. Her work is held in numerous private and corporate collections in South Africa and across Europe.
